基于相位分析的曲轴结构设计方法

A Method of Crankshaft Structure Design Based on Phase Analysis

  • 摘要: 曲轴一般由若干个曲拐单元构成,将若干个曲拐单元按照一定的相位连接起来,再加上前端、后端和平衡重便构成了一根曲轴。在这个逻辑基础上,本文以非道路LR4A发动机所用曲轴为例,阐述了其结构特点和布局形式,进行了相关分析和总结,最终形成一个思路简单、使用方便的曲轴结构建模设计方法。

     

    Abstract: The crankshaft is basically made up of a number of crank units, if we connect serval crank units in a certain phase, combine the front end, bank end and the banlance weight, then a crack shaft is formed. Based on this logic, this paper takes the crankshaft used in a non-road LR4 A engine as an example, describes its structural features an layout, and carries on the relevant analysis and summary.It finally forms a simple and convenient crankshaft modeling design method.
